A PAC can give a candidate up to $10,000 per election cycle — $5,000 for the primary and $5,000 for the general — so totals spanning two cycles run to about $20,000 at the top end. Occasional larger figures usually mean a special election or a runoff, which counts as another election. Giving through CONTINUING AMERICA'S STRENGTH AND SECURITY PAC.
